Student Worker Gifts
Last week I took my three student workers out for lunch to thank them for all their hard work this past semester. We had a really nice lunch at Mimi's restaurant and then I gave them each a little gift. I had made these three note holders for on their desks. It's a little wooden crate covered with DSP.
Then I added a paper flower to spruce them up a bit.
Cut up copy paper to make some cute little notes, stamping some of them in a matching color.
And put in an RSVP pen with a matching DSP insert. I think they turned out really cute. Here are the 3 of them all made up.
All ready for gift giving.
Hope they liked them and know how much I appreciate them. ~Maureen
